Minimums By Print Method
Certain print methods also have item minimums that apply, on top of the $350 order value. These come down to the setup each method requires.
Screen Print
- Minimum 20 units per design
- Covers the extensive setup — films, screens and press setup are prepared for every colour in your design
- Keeps the per-unit price sharp as quantities climb
Digital Print
- No unit minimum
- Products are always cheaper when purchased in bulk
- The first discount kicks in at just 5 units, and keeps scaling from there
Embroidery
- Minimum 10 units per design
- Your logo is digitised once into a stitch file, then run on every garment
- Keeps the setup worthwhile for you and for us

Do the item minimums apply per design or per order?
Do the item minimums apply per design or per order?
Per design.
Screen print is 20 units per design and embroidery is 10 units per design. If you're running two different designs, each one needs to meet its own minimum.
